Cessna 207 N1590U

14 November 1971 · Anchorage, Alaska, United States · No injuries

Summary

On 14 November 1971 at about 16:00 local time, a Cessna 207 registered N1590U, operated by Alaska Aeronau, was involved in an accident during the landing phase of flight near Anchorage, Alaska, United States. 2 people were on board and nobody was injured. The aircraft was destroyed. No probable cause statement is available for this record.

Read the full NTSB narrative

DITCHED IN COOK INLET. ACFT SANK, WASNT RECOVERED

Quoted verbatim from the NTSB record.
